Kate Osamor vs Dr Roz Savage

A side-by-side comparison of voting participation, party rebellion, topic focus, and recent voting overlap.


Voting alignment

Kate Osamor and Dr Roz Savage voted the same way 16% of the time, based on 202 shared comparable votes.

32 same votes 170 different votes 202 shared votes

Alignment only includes divisions where both MPs recorded an Aye or No vote. Tellers, absences, abstentions, and missing votes are excluded.
